Straight line yaw formula rock wool pendulum cloth cotton machine
Technical field
The present invention relates to cloth cotton equipment, the specifically a kind of straight line yaw formula rock wool pendulum cloth cotton machine in a kind of rock wool production line.
Background technology
Pendulum cloth cotton machine is the key equipment in the rock wool production line of ore deposit.Its radical function is by the initial cotton felt collected from cotton collecting machine and a felt, again stacking with arrangement, to meet the requirement of shaping cotton felt and secondary felt width and thickness, waits processing to create favorable conditions, and significantly improve cotton plate performance for profiled section is pleating.
Current pendulum cloth cotton machine adopts push-down to drive usually, pendulum belt conveyor upper end is articulated and connected by dead axle and frame, promote pendulum belt conveyor along dead axle reciprocally swinging by driving device by push rod, the space of rock wool in the middle of pendulum belt conveyor falls and cloth cotton is carried out in the swing of following pendulum belt conveyor.The major defect of this device has: the upper end of pendulum belt conveyor is around fixed-axis rotation, the path of motion of its lower end and end is one section of circular arc, when actuating device uniform rotation, in different swing position, the horizontal component velocity difference of pendulum Belt Conveying end of tape is larger, circular arc two ends swing speed is slow, middle swing speed is fast, and no matter the rock wool felt speed being transported to pendulum Belt Conveying end of tape be swinging the midway location of circular arc or end positions is all at the uniform velocity, the rock wool that such cloth goes out felt just occurs that stacking of two ends are high, stacking of centre is low, thus cause the unit weight of rock wool finished product larger in Width gap, and rock wool felt is wider, pendulum amplitude of fluctuation is also larger, larger on the impact of rock wool finished product unit weight deviation.A few devices adopts and arranges horizontal rail in pendulum belt conveyor bottom, but complex structure, manufacturing cost is high, is not easy installation and maintenance.
Summary of the invention
In order to overcome above-mentioned defect, to provide a kind of pendulum belt conveyor oscillator arc little in the present invention, the cotton uniform rock wool pendulum cloth cotton machine of cloth.
The technical solution used in the present invention is: a kind of straight line yaw formula rock wool pendulum cloth cotton machine, comprise motor, crank, push rod and pendulum belt conveyor, motor is connected with connecting rod by crank, connecting rod is articulated and connected by push rod and pendulum belt conveyor, pendulum belt conveyor is vertically arranged on the below of belt conveyor one end, and the end of belt conveyor is positioned at the top of pendulum belt conveyor input end, it is characterized in that: described push rod is made up of horizontal push rod and perpendicular push rod, horizontal push rod one end is connected with rod hinge connection, the other end is connected with the upper end thereof of perpendicular push rod, the stage casing of perpendicular push rod is articulated and connected by the stage casing of rotating shaft and pendulum belt conveyor, also comprise fixed mount, fixed mount is fixedly connected with frame, fixed mount is made up of transverse slat and riser, transverse slat horizontal welding is in riser lower end and form rectangular-shaped with riser, the lower end of described perpendicular push rod is connected with lagging hinge, the upper end of riser and the stage casing of belt conveyor are articulated and connected, and the end of belt conveyor and the input end of pendulum belt conveyor are articulated and connected.
It is fulcrum that traditional fixed type belt conveyor is improved to stage casing by the present invention, the lever-type structure that two ends can swing up and down, and pendulum belt conveyor is improved to floating type by traditional upper end dead axle, the end of belt conveyor is connected with pendulum belt conveyor upper end thereof, pendulum belt conveyor stage casing and lower push-rod are articulated and connected, like this, belt conveyor, pendulum belt conveyor, lower push-rod and upper push-rod composition four-bar linkage, in addition, connecting rod, upper push-rod, lower push-rod and transverse slat also form four-bar linkage, when motor makes reciprocally swinging by crank handle turns connecting rod, connecting rod drives the upper end of lower push-rod to swing by upper push-rod, during swing, the lower end of lower push-rod is that dead axle is so motionless, when so lower push-rod drives pendulum belt conveyor to swing by rotating shaft, can to pendulum belt conveyor one thrust upwards, again because pendulum belt conveyor is floating type, so its entirety also can move up while the swing of pendulum belt conveyor lower end, drive the end of belt conveyor upwards to swing simultaneously.When the present invention utilizes lower push-rod to swing, arcuate oscillating motion is upwards to offset the downward arcuate oscillating motion of pendulum belt conveyor, significantly reduce the radian that pendulum belt conveyor swings, structure of the present invention is simple, low cost of manufacture, just can realize straight line yaw formula cloth cotton without the need to arranging horizontal rail in pendulum belt conveyor bottom, thus reach the cotton uniform effect of cloth.

Detailed description of the invention
Now the invention will be further described by reference to the accompanying drawings, the technical solution used in the present invention is: a kind of straight line yaw formula rock wool pendulum cloth cotton machine, comprise motor 1, crank, push rod and pendulum belt conveyor 6 etc., motor 1 is connected with connecting rod 3 by crank, connecting rod 3 is articulated and connected by push rod and pendulum belt conveyor 6, pendulum belt conveyor 6 is vertically arranged on the below of belt conveyor 7 one end, and the end of belt conveyor 7 is positioned at the top of pendulum belt conveyor 6 input end, described push rod is made up of horizontal push rod 4 and perpendicular push rod 5, horizontal push rod 4 one end and connecting rod 3 are articulated and connected, the other end is connected with the upper end thereof of perpendicular push rod 5, the stage casing of perpendicular push rod 5 is articulated and connected by the stage casing of rotating shaft and pendulum belt conveyor 6, also comprise fixed mount, fixed mount is fixedly connected with frame, fixed mount is made up of transverse slat 9 and riser 8, transverse slat 9 horizontal welding is in riser 8 lower end and form rectangular-shaped with riser 8, lower end and the transverse slat 9 of described perpendicular push rod 5 are articulated and connected, the upper end of riser 8 and the stage casing of belt conveyor 7 are articulated and connected, and the end of belt conveyor 7 and the input end of pendulum belt conveyor 6 are articulated and connected.
When the present invention uses, a poor quality cotton felt is transported to through some grades of belt conveyor 7 in the folder gap in pendulum belt conveyor 6 by cotton collecting machine, then falls forming transporter from pendulum belt conveyor 6 lower end and carries out cloth cotton.The swing of pendulum belt conveyor 6 is achieved in that motor 1 makes reciprocally swinging by crank handle turns connecting rod 3, connecting rod 3 drives the upper end of lower push-rod to swing by upper push-rod, lower push-rod drives the bottom of pendulum belt conveyor 6 to swing by the rotating shaft at middle part, during swing, lower end due to lower push-rod is that dead axle is so motionless, lower push-rod is when swinging, the path of motion of its upper end is an arc upwards, when so lower push-rod drives pendulum belt conveyor 6 to swing by rotating shaft, pendulum belt conveyor 6 one thrust upwards will be given, again because pendulum belt conveyor 6 is floating type, so its entirety also can move up while the swing of pendulum belt conveyor 6 lower end, add side, pendulum belt conveyor 6 upper end and belt conveyor 7 is articulated and connected, the upper end of pendulum belt conveyor 6 only can move up and down and can not sway, so pendulum belt conveyor 6 can drive the end of belt conveyor 7 to swing up and down while moving up and down.Therefore, when the present invention utilizes lower push-rod to swing, arcuate oscillating motion is upwards to offset the downward arcuate oscillating motion of pendulum belt conveyor 6, significantly reduces the radian that pendulum belt conveyor 6 swings.Be 2.5 meters with length, monolateral pendulum angle is the pendulum belt conveyor 6 of 14.7 degree is example, the path of motion that traditional pendulum belt conveyor 6 lower end swings: the straight-line distance at the middle lowest part of arc and the two ends place of arc is 14.6 centimetres; Use the path of motion of the pendulum belt conveyor 6 of structure of the present invention: the straight-line distance at the middle lowest part of arc and the two ends place of arc is 4.5 centimetres, and path of motion is approximately straight line, the horizontal velocity of pendulum belt conveyor 6 is close at the uniform velocity.Structure of the present invention is simple, low cost of manufacture, just can realize straight line yaw formula cloth cotton without the need to arranging horizontal rail in pendulum belt conveyor 6 bottom, thus reaches the cotton uniform effect of cloth.
